<h2>How can you help us?</h2>
<p>The most direct way to support the <a
href="../documents/whatwedo.html">work</a> and <a
href="../documents/whyweexist.html">goals</a> of the FSF Europe is
through volunteering for things that need to be done. We are extremely
glad about the help we have received from the community so far and
welcome every new contributor.</p>
<p>If you haven't done so already, we suggest that you subscribe to
the FSF Europe
<a href="http://mail.fsfeurope.org/mailman/listinfo">mailing lists</a>
you're
interested in and take a look at the archives to see what has been
discussed already.
</p>
<p>If you feel you can and want to help with one or the other task,
a mail to an appropriate mailing list is a good way of getting
involved. If you do not find a good list to use you can
also send emails to the international <a href="mailto:team@fsfeurope.org">
<code>team@fsfeurope.org</code></a>.
</p>

<h3>Tradeshow booths</h3>
<ul>
<p>The FSF Europe has to get in touch with people outside the
community to make them realize there is more to Free Software than
just nice programs and to familiarize them with the FSF.</p>
<p>An important part of this is being present at tradeshows. But
although we can normally provide everything needed to set up such a
booth, there is one thing we cannot simply generate: people.</p>
<p>We need volunteers to be present at the booths, talk to people,
explain to them the philosophy of Free Software and what the FSF and
GNU Project are all about and simply be there. Nothing looks worse
than an empty tradeshow booth. Also we prefer to have local volunteers
take over organization of the booths.</p>
<p>Organisation of the tradeshow appearances usually
happens over the language localised list or on the
<a href="http://mail.fsfeurope.org/mailman/listinfo/booth"
>booth coordination list</a>.
</p>
